What Are the Indian Lottery Rules?

In India, lotteries are governed by the Indian lottery rules, which state governments primarily set. Lotteries are regulated on a state level, which means the Indian lottery rules vary depending on where you live. While some states have legalized and regulated lottery games, others have outright banned them. This means that, in India, lotteries are not governed by a single set of national laws. Instead, the rules and regulations differ from state to state.

Each state that allows lotteries has its own set of Indian lottery rules. These Indian lottery rules govern how the lottery is conducted, who can participate, how the prizes are distributed, and the overall fairness of the game. Some common elements that most state-run lotteries share include:

  1. Ticket Purchase: Players can buy lottery tickets from authorized retailers or, in some cases, from official online platforms where it is permitted.
  2. Draw Dates and Times: State lotteries have specific draw dates and times when winners are announced.
  3. Prize Distribution: The Indian lottery rules define how winners are selected and how the prizes are paid out, whether in lump sums or installments.
  4. Age Restrictions: Typically, only individuals over 18 can participate in the lottery.
  5. Taxation: The winnings from lottery prizes are taxable under Indian law, and the amount varies depending on the prize size.

Is Online Lottery Legal in India?

One of the most frequently asked questions about Indian lotteries is: Is online lottery legal in India? The answer to this question is nuanced because online lotteries’ legality depends on state laws and the platform offering the lottery.

According to the Public Gambling Act of 1867, online gambling, including lottery games, is illegal in India. However, this law applies only to physical gambling establishments and does not explicitly address the issue of online lotteries. Over time, various states have chosen their approach toward online gambling and lottery games.

Some states have legalized online lotteries and have official online platforms where residents can buy tickets and participate. These states typically include Sikkim, Goa, and Kerala, which have established online lottery systems where tickets can be purchased through their state-authorized websites.

On the other hand, many states have either banned or don’t regulate online lotteries. In states like Maharashtra and Telangana, offline and online lotteries are strictly prohibited. There’s a legal gray area for states where online lottery is not explicitly addressed, and it’s up to local law enforcement to determine whether these games are permitted.

If you’re interested in playing the lottery online, it’s crucial to check your state’s specific Indian rules lottery regarding the legality of online lotteries. If your state allows online participation, only using trusted, licensed, and authorized platforms is essential to avoid any legal complications.

How to Find the Latest Lottery Result

Once you’ve purchased your lottery ticket and eagerly await the lottery result, there are several reliable ways to check the results. In India, lotteries are generally drawn on specific days, and the results are made public soon after. Here’s where and how you can find out whether you’ve won:

  1. Official Websites: If you’re participating in a state-run lottery, the first place to check for results is the official website of the state lottery. For example, if you’re playing the Kerala State Lottery, the official website will publish the lottery result shortly after the draw.
  2. Authorized Retailers: Many local retailers who sell lottery tickets also display the winning numbers. Once the results are announced, you can visit a local shop to check if you’re one of the lucky winners.
  3. Newspapers: Results for most major state lotteries are published in the newspapers the day after the draw. This is a traditional but reliable method to check the lottery result.
  4. SMS and Apps: Some states offer the option to check results via SMS or mobile apps. These services send you updates on winning numbers directly to your phone, so you don’t have to look for them.
  5. Television: In some states, the lottery results are broadcast live on local television channels, especially for bigger draws. This is often the case for large jackpot lotteries.

Understanding Taxation on Lottery Winnings

While winning a lottery can be exciting, it’s essential to know that your winnings are subject to tax under Indian law. According to the Income Tax Act of India, lottery winnings are considered income taxed at a flat rate of 30%. This means that once you win a prize, 30% of the amount is deducted as tax before you receive your prize. Additionally, if the award exceeds ₹10,000, the government deducts tax at source (TDS).

For example, if you win ₹ one crore in a lottery, 30% or ₹30 lakh will be deducted as tax, and you’ll receive ₹70 lakh as your prize money. It’s always a good idea to consult with a tax professional if you win a large sum to ensure you comply with all tax regulations.
